Si→SiO2 transformation: Interfacial structure and mechanism
Abstract
We show that the c-Si→a-SiO2 transformation takes place via an ordered crystalline oxide layer ≃5 Å thick. Modeling of high-resolution transmission electron-microscope lattice images in two projections suggests the crystalline oxide to be tridymite, a stable, bulk form of SiO2.
